About this hospital

    The BPK Hospital Group was founded by Dr. Chareong Chandrakamol and Associate Professor Pittaya Chandrakamol in 1981 under the name of Bangpakok Polyclinic. Providing quality care and service to all patients, the polyclinic’s reputation grew immensely amongst the people and needed to be expanded. The polyclinic has eventually moved location and was established as Bangpakok 1 Hospital, with a vision to be fully-equipped facility, and a team of expert doctors in all specialties, Dr. Chareong Chandrakamol and the BPK Hospital Group’s executive board expanded their network of hospitals throughout Bangkok and surrounding areas.

  1. Bangpakok 1 Hospital (since 1994)
  2. Bangpakok 3 Hospital (since 1996)
  3. Bangpakok 8 International Hospital (since 2003)
  4. Bangpakok 9 International Hospital (since 2003)
  5. Bangpakok 2 Hospital (established in 1990)
  6. Bangpakok Medical Clinic (establish in 1981)
  7. Piyavate Hospital (under BPK Hospital Group since 1 January 2016)
  8. Bangpakok 2 Rangsit Hospital (under BPK Hospital Group since 1 January 2016)

 

    BPK9 International Hospital is one of the leading private hospitals in Thailand, and under the BPK Hospital Group. The Group was founded by Dr. Chareong Chandrakamol and Associate Professor Bidhya Chandrakamol in 2003. The hospital is located only 30 minutes from Bangkok’s Suvarnabhumi Airport, a little south of Central Bangkok, on Rama 2 Road, in the area of Bangpakok, near the famous Chao Praya River.  The hospital is quipped with expert teams of doctors, very latest medical equipment, and technologies certified by JCI (Joint Commission International) and HA (Hospital Accreditation, Bangpakok 9 International Hospital is ready to providing local and international patients with high standards of medical care.
